§ 22-24. Police radios prohibited.

No towing company nor any owner, operator, employee, or agent of a towing company, whether licensed under this subtitle or not, may:

(1) possess at his, her, or its garage, repair shop, or other place of business any radio-receiving set capable of receiving signals or messages transmitted on frequencies allocated for use by the Police Department; or

(2) in connection with any towing operations, make use of any signals or messages transmitted by the Police Department on frequencies allocated for its use.
